Douglas Coupland was born on a NATO base in Germany in 1961. He is the author of the international bestseller JPod , and eight earlier novels, including Hey Nostradamus! , All Families Are Psychotic and Generation X . His books have been translated into thirty-five languages and published in most countries around the world. He is also a visual artist, sculptor, furniture designer and screenwriter, who is adapting JPod as a television series. He lives and works in Vancouver. From the Hardcover edition.

This is, essentially, a re-working of the play/film 'Who's Afraid of Virginia Woolf'. Initially cold and sterile - like Staples, the setting for much of the book - the characters grew on me and I warmed to the idea of getting to know them through the novel (within a novel) being written by one of the characters.The Gum Thief is an interesting character study, very easy to read and lots of interesting ideas about modern lives.
